Background technique
As the important component of smart grid, effective application of distributing automation apparatus is the emphasis studied at present. Conventional terminal detection, fault detector detection and complete set of equipments detection use different pilot systems, and detection efficiency is very low, It is difficult to carry out full inspection before equipment linked network on a large scale.There are three types of the mode of distribution terminal joint debugging at present is general, one kind is that people debugs in main website Commander member, field adjustable personnel operation, both sides are completed by way of telephone mutual information, and which has single device joint debugging and disappears The long problem of time-consuming;One kind is that main website commissioning staff participates in the overall process debugging process, using which, when the terminal quantity of debugging When more, person works' pressure is huge, influences the correctness and integrality of joint debugging work;Another kind is that fortune is also born simultaneously by main website Row work, joint debugging plan is not easy to arrange under this kind of mode, and progress is not easy to control, and the case where joint debugging task-delay, shadow often occurs Distribution terminal is rung to check and accept and put into operation.

A kind of full type self adaption of power distribution automation debugs mandatory system, as shown in Figure 1, the system by combined adjuster, match Electric equipment terminal, data base management system (Database Management System) and platform composition, have DMS and show The ability of field combined adjuster interactive information.Combined adjuster is connected by WIFI with platform, and platform passes through network and database system It is connected, and Database Systems are connected further through distribution private network with controller switching equipment terminal, combined adjuster passes through control voltage and current Switching value and then control controller switching equipment terminal.
As shown in Fig. 2, extension has the wireless network card and 4G network interface card of USB interface on combined adjuster, make its support WIFI and 4G, establishes WIFI hot spot, and mobile phone accesses hot spot, connecting platform by WIFI.Combined adjuster is exchanged by power grid mouth RJ45 connection Source and switch motion simulation mechanism, and then current and voltage quantities, alternating current source output AC voltage and electric current are controlled, switch motion simulation Mechanism input/output switching value.The alternating current of alternating current source output is by cable connection large-current electric magnetic simulation frame, by defeated Lesser electric current obtains equivalent large-current electric magnetic field effect out, and then controls voltage and current switching value.
Wherein, alternating current source includes three-phase independent current and four phase independent voltage sources.
Wherein, large-current electric magnetic simulation frame includes multiturn coil and primary opening current transformer.
Wherein, alternating current source output current scope is 0~6A, and output electric current is not directly accessed secondary current circuit, but Multiturn coil is accessed, then will once be open current transformer card on the coil, in this way, even if only exporting a low current, Also the equivalent effect for being once passed through high current can be obtained by the multiturn coil.
Wherein, switch motion simulation mechanism uses 4U19 inch standard cabinet, installs 2 blocks of intake plug-in units and 4 pieces are outputed Plug-in unit is measured, each plug-in unit includes 8 switching values.
Joint debugging process includes:
Remote signalling joint debugging: sending on combined adjuster after joint debugging remote signals, starts combined adjuster, and system obtains current remote signalling Value, system if it is considered to cannot joint debugging, then response cannot be executed by passing down, and combined adjuster, which receives to execute to respond, then to be stopped filling It sets;Otherwise response can be executed by passing down, while being started timing and being monitored that remote signalling conjugates;Combined adjuster receives after capable of executing response manually Displacement passes through switch motion simulation mechanism automatic displacement;System is in the case where monitoring corresponding remote signalling displacement then before timing terminates It passes successfully, otherwise passes failure down.
Relay protective scheme verification: sending on combined adjuster after joint debugging relay protective scheme signal, starts combined adjuster, if system is recognized For cannot joint debugging, then response cannot be executed by passing down, and combined adjuster, which receives to execute, responds then arresting stop;Otherwise energy is passed down Execute response, while starting timing and monitoring corresponding remote signalling displacement, and according to relay protective scheme type output state sequence or Play back recorded wave file;System monitors corresponding remote signalling displacement before timing terminates and then passes down successfully, otherwise passes failure down.
Recorded wave file playback: sending on combined adjuster after playing back recorded wave file serial number, starts combined adjuster, if system is recognized For cannot joint debugging, then response cannot be executed by passing down, and combined adjuster, which receives to execute, responds then arresting stop;Otherwise energy is passed down Response is executed, while starting timing and monitoring corresponding recorded wave file, and playing back corresponding recorded wave file;Joint debugging main website is in timing knot Corresponding recorded wave file is monitored before beam, checks its consistency with original file content, is unanimously then passed successfully down, is otherwise passed down Failure.
Within the system, controller switching equipment terminal can also use cloud storage and internet label technology, i.e. controller switching equipment is whole End when leaving the factory, should post dedicated two-dimension code label on device, controller switching equipment terminal protection can be read by two dimensional code link The essential information of device, and it is stored in cloud server.Controller switching equipment end message obtains the realization of cloud strategy, specifically includes that two Tie up code scanning recognition device, cloud server, PC.Above-mentioned two-dimension code label is scanned with two-dimensional code scanning device, and scanning is tied Fruit exports to PC, model, nominal parameter, the protection definite value relevant information of PC display identification tested device, by wifi by data It is uploaded to cloud server, is matched with the data information of the original typing of relevant device in cloud server, to guarantee information Accurate reliability, while not stored information being backed up.Meanwhile cloud server is according to the function and property of test system Can, providing needs project to be tested.
